Sound can be described in terms of its properties and characteristics such as pitch, intensity, duration, timbre and texture or musical properties such as rhythm, melody and harmony. Sound is the term to describe what is heard when sound waves pass through a medium to the ear. All sounds are made by vibrations of molecules through which the sound travels. For example, if a flute and an oboe are playing the same note, the pitch may be the same, but the timbre of each of the sounds is very different. Timbre describes the sound quality of a specific instrument. Bad quality: It's not wrong, but it may not describe that quality exactly. Tone color, also known as timbre, is the quality that defines the unique characteristics and nuances of an instrument's sound.
